I used to think they were entirely useless, but since then I've learned of many instances where a much better technology is developed because the first iteration is patented.
For example, the Wright brothers biggest contribution to aviation was suing everyone using wing warping (https://en.wikipedia.org/wiki/Wright_brothers_patent_war) which greatly advanced the adoption of the much more advanced ailerons.
Software patents have a similar effect, for example Cisco's patent on Virtual Router Redundancy Protocol led to the development of the more secure and more capable Common Address Redundancy Protocol (https://jacobfilipp.com/DrDobbs/articles/SA/v14/i05/a6.htm).
We tend to invest heavily in whatever we can get working first, but it's rarely close to an ideal way of doing something. By pushing every developer to find a newer, better way of doing something, patents prevent stagnation and lead to more advanced technologies.
The wright brothers patent was not on wing warping, it was on controlling a vehicle in the air. In short the Wright brothers did not invent the aeroplane they invented how to control a aeroplane.
https://www.wright-brothers.org/History_Wing/Wright_Story/Sh...
"We wish it to be understood, however, that our invention is not limited to this particular construction, since any construction whereby the angular relations of the lateral margins of the aeroplanes may be varied in opposite directions with respect to the normal planes of said aeroplanes comes within the scope of our invention."
Some people (Curtis) felt this claim was far too encompassing and should not be enforced. > Cisco's patent on Virtual Router Redundancy Protocol led to the development of the more secure and more capable Common Address Redundancy Protocol
This seems like a success story in spite of software patents, not because of them. Just because they were forced to develop a new protocol in order to avoid getting sued for using Cisco's doesn't mean that they wouldn't still have improved on what Cisco had if they'd been allowed to use and modify it freely. The lack of lawsuits hanging over everyone's head certainly hasn't prevented innovation from happening in FOSS.

The fact that some innovations succeeded despite having to tiptoe around patents is more of an example of survivorship bias.
When we get something working first, there are probably some optimal partial solutions there. Working around the patent means having to do some things inefficiently while being able to provide better efficiency or cost of the overall system.
In my work, I all too often see that the obvious optimal solution we come up with turns out to be patented and we are spending time on finding least bad worse solution.
